The time when Travancore said no to longer Onam holidays in Keralam
In 1930s, Travancore Sri Mulam Assembly faced demands to extend Onam public holidays to 10 days, contrasting with the 11-day Christmas-New Year break. But then Chief Secretary N. Kunjan Pillai rejected the proposal, citing sufficient annual holidays
